We just got off the June 15 Disney Magic. I had read reports that we should take dramimine before the pirate boat excursion and I was glad I listened! ::yes:: We had an awesome day, but the boat really rocks. The pirates handed out dramimine for anyone that needed it during the day. Just thought I would send out a reminder for anyone planning to do this excursion in the future.

Quick Summary of the Excursion:
Your pirate for the day will meet you at the Magic and walk you over to the pirate boat. The pirates really stay in character throughout the day and are awesome. During the walk over, they will take your lunch order. Our choices were chicken, mahi mahi, hamburgers, and hotdogs (I think). We had a seasick child earlier in the day and decided not to risk going back down to the galley to eat. My brother-in-law had the chicken and said it was good. We had brought goldfish and crackers in our beach bag which worked out perfect for us. Once you arrive on the pirate boat, you will have your family picture made with the pirate. They will offer to sale this photo to you at the end of the cruise ($15 I think). We didn't purchase our picture. You will be given the chance for your child to have their picture made with the pirates at the end of the cruise with your own camera - no charge. During the entire trip, your pirate of the day will make sure that you have everything you need. Sodas, bottled water, smoothies, beer, and mixed drinks are available. You will also have the opportunity to eat breakfast on the boat before you leave. We have a picky eater and decided to eat on the cruise ship before we left, so I'm not sure of the options. The pirates get everyone involved from the very beginning. There is singing, dancing, and an ongoing skit as you make your way to the beach. They will also put up a sun shade as soon as they have fired the cannons and guns. The shade was a welcome relief on our very hot day. The ride to the beach was a couple of hours. You will be transferred to the beach by a small boat. We stayed at the beach for 2 hours. It was great. The water temperature was perfect. They have boogy boards, kayaks, and banana boat rides. Drinks were also served on the beach. You could also choose to snorkel, but due to the jelly fish we chose not to. After your time at the beach, you are transferred back to the pirate boat for lunch and the trip back. We had a fun day. The pirates went out of their way to make sure you were well taken care of.
